Reviewed by Mike Rimmer

One of the best unsigned bands in the USA. Dog Named David are duo Andy Cloniger and John Wallace with a pair of acoustic guitars, a fine set of songs and a bit of a rhythm section to help things along. The title tune from this album was featured on the 'Mindy's Revenge" compilation thus raising the band's presence and a fine bit of pop writing it is. There's more of the same on the album which has been available for about a year. Their sound is the perfect syncopation of guitars and voices both intertwining their way through this set of songs. "I Feel" is slow, poetic and moody; "World Is Round" and "Too Young" are strident; "What I Need" opens the album and sets the scene and boy! These guys can play! Since both guys are college grads, you can expect lyrics that are thought provoking and touching. Sometimes they sing beautiful harmonies, sometimes their voices dance round each other. To be honest, I can see this appealing to fans of Jars Of Clay's slower songs and beyond! If you like intelligent music and acoustic pop, you need to seek out a copy of 'It's Alright' because this private recording is right on the money!
